iPay Technologies Selects VeriSign Identity
Protection Fraud Detection Service for Risk-Based Authentication
VeriSign Strengthens Online Bill Payment Providers Online Fraud Detection
MOUNTAIN VIEW, CA., July 18, 2006 – VeriSign, Inc., (NASDAQ: VRSN),
the leading provider of intelligent infrastructure services for Internet
and telecommunications networks, today announced that iPay Technologies
has selected the VeriSign® Identity Protection (VIP) Fraud Detection
Service to provide online security for its customers and financial institutions,
further establishing VeriSign as a leader in Internet security services
for the financial services industry. Under terms of the agreement, iPay
Technologies will deploy the VIP Fraud Detection Service to secure customer
login and transaction information.

FFIEC guidelines require financial institutions to
implement multi-factor authentication in an Internet banking environment
by the end of this year. The VIP Fraud Detection Service is a component
of the VeriSign® Identity Protection program, which is a layered authentication
approach that provides risk-based and multi-factor authentication as
well as a single security method consumers can use to authenticate themselves
across any VIP-enabled Web site. Using advanced anomaly detection technology,
the VIP Fraud Detection Service provides a non-intrusive means of delivering
identity and transaction protection to consumers offering financial
institutions an easy to deploy, cost effective solution for FFIEC compliance.

One of the greatest challenges for banks in meeting
the FFIEC guidelines is ease and speed of deployment. Most vendor solutions
require complex integrations. At a minimum, custom code must be added
to the application to invoke the fraud engine custom APIs.
The VIP Fraud Detection Service does not require any new code to be
written by the bank, thus, offering one of the fastest paths to FFIEC
compliance available on the market today.
